Organizational Setting

The main aim of the FAO country offices, which are headed by an FAO Representative, is to assist governments to develop policies, programmes and projects to achieve food security and to reduce hunger and malnutrition, to help develop the agricultural, fisheries and forestry sectors, and to use their environmental and natural resources in a sustainable manner.

Reporting Lines

The incumbent will report to the Assistant FAO Representative (Programme), under the overall supervision of the Sub Regional Coordinator and the technical supervision of the Administrative Officer in the SAP office.

Technical Focus

Administrative support

Tasks and responsibilities

• Maintain petty Cash accounts; reconcile expenditures, balances, payments, statements and other data; assist in the preparation of recurring and special reports by preparing and editing data in appropriate format as requested; monitor project, programme and general office accounts. • Manage and process utility bills and develop monthly utility bill checklists to ensure utility bills are paid on time; • Support on the local bank operations and to keep up-to-date with financial and regulatory information (Support the administration of personnel and equipment; • Maintain local assets and inventory records with responsibility for proper recording of assets, their maintenance and safeguard • Support the local travel/International travel functions; • Responsible for registration of NST travelers • Maintain the travel data base for international and local travel request; • Assist in clearing outstanding travel-related balances through reviewing travellers’ recovery lists and taking the necessary follow-up action; • Identify, review and claim refunds of travel costs from travel agents or travellers and take necessary follow up action; • Help on office communication (Telephone system) if needed; • Undertake responsibility for Stationery, acting as the Custodian and keeping record of management • Maintain a filing system of administrative and financial documents; • Retrieve, enter, select and analyse data from a wide variety of sources, including FAO’s corporate systems and data bases; verify accuracy of data documents; make necessary calculations. • Support the overall hiring plan for hiring of national and international affiliate workforce • Coordinate and manage the publication of calls to attract candidates for vacancies related to national and international affiliate workforce, ensuring proper dissemination to attract qualified talent; • Prepare routine correspondence of administrative nature; draft correspondence to verify data, answer queries, and obtain additional information on transactions and financial matters, as required. • Perform other related duties as required.
